纯本地实时语音转文字:开启高效交互新纪元
2025.09.23 12:35浏览量:0简介:本文深入探讨纯本地实时语音转文字技术,解析其工作原理、优势、应用场景及开发建议,助力开发者与企业用户提升效率与安全性。
起飞,纯本地实时语音转文字!——技术解析与行业应用
在数字化浪潮席卷全球的今天,语音交互已成为人机交互的重要形式。从智能客服到会议记录,从车载系统到无障碍设备,语音转文字技术(ASR)的需求持续攀升。然而,传统云端ASR方案依赖网络传输与第三方服务,存在延迟高、隐私风险、成本不可控等痛点。纯本地实时语音转文字技术的崛起,正以“零延迟、高安全、低成本”的核心优势,重新定义语音交互的效率边界。
一、纯本地实时语音转文字:技术原理与核心优势
1.1 技术原理:端到端的本地化处理
纯本地ASR的核心在于将语音识别模型部署在终端设备(如PC、手机、嵌入式设备)上,通过本地麦克风采集音频,直接在设备内完成声学特征提取、声学模型匹配、语言模型解码等全流程处理,最终输出文本结果。这一过程无需上传音频至云端,彻底摆脱网络依赖。
关键技术组件:
- 声学模型:将音频波形转换为音素或字词概率分布(如CNN、RNN、Transformer架构)。
- 语言模型:基于统计或神经网络的语言规则库,优化输出文本的语法合理性(如N-gram、BERT)。
- 解码器:结合声学模型与语言模型,通过动态规划算法(如Viterbi)生成最优文本序列。
1.2 核心优势:效率、安全与成本的三角突破
- 零延迟交互:本地处理省去网络传输与云端计算时间,实时性达毫秒级,适用于直播字幕、实时会议等场景。
- 数据隐私保障:音频与文本数据全程留存于本地,避免云端泄露风险,满足医疗、金融等高敏感行业合规要求。
- 离线可用性:无网络环境下仍可正常工作,拓展至野外作业、地下空间等特殊场景。
- 长期成本优化:一次性授权或开源模型部署,规避云端服务按量计费模式,降低TCO(总拥有成本)。
二、应用场景:从效率工具到行业变革
2.1 高效办公:会议记录与多语言支持
- 实时会议转录:在跨国视频会议中,本地ASR可同步生成多语言字幕,支持中文、英语、西班牙语等30+语种,消除语言障碍。
- 离线笔记整理:律师、记者等职业可在无网络环境下录音并实时转文字,后续通过本地编辑工具(如OCR+ASR结合)快速生成文档。
2.2 无障碍交互:包容性设计的突破
- 听障人士辅助:通过手机或智能眼镜的本地ASR,实时将对话转换为文字显示,实现“所见即所听”。
- 方言与小众语言保护:开源本地ASR模型可针对方言(如粤语、闽南语)或濒危语言进行定制训练,推动文化多样性保存。
2.3 工业与车载:高可靠性的实时决策
- 工业设备监控:在工厂环境中,本地ASR可实时识别设备异常声音并转文字报警,避免因网络中断导致的生产事故。
- 车载语音交互:无网络的车载系统通过本地ASR实现导航指令、音乐控制等操作,提升驾驶安全性。
三、开发实践:从模型选型到性能优化
3.1 模型选型:轻量化与高精度的平衡
- 开源框架推荐:
- Vosk:支持离线多语言,模型体积小(如中文模型约50MB),适合嵌入式设备。
- Mozilla DeepSpeech:基于TensorFlow,提供预训练英语模型,可微调至特定场景。
- Kaldi:传统ASR工具链,适合需要深度定制的开发者。
- 量化与剪枝:通过8位量化、层剪枝等技术,将模型体积压缩至原大小的10%-30%,同时保持90%以上准确率。
3.2 硬件适配:跨平台的性能调优
- 移动端优化:
- Android/iOS:利用硬件加速(如Android NNAPI、iOS Core ML)提升推理速度。
- 内存管理:采用流式处理,分块加载音频数据,避免内存溢出。
- 嵌入式设备:
- 树莓派/Jetson:选择轻量级模型(如MobileNet架构),通过GPU或NPU加速。
- 低功耗设计:动态调整采样率(如从16kHz降至8kHz),减少计算量。
3.3 代码示例:基于Vosk的Python实现
from vosk import Model, KaldiRecognizer
import pyaudio
# 加载模型(需提前下载对应语言模型)
model = Model("path/to/vosk-model-small-cn-0.15") # 中文模型示例
recognizer = KaldiRecognizer(model, 16000) # 采样率16kHz
# 音频流处理
p = pyaudio.PyAudio()
stream = p.open(format=pyaudio.paInt16, channels=1, rate=16000, input=True, frames_per_buffer=4096)
while True:
data = stream.read(4096)
if recognizer.AcceptWaveform(data):
result = recognizer.Result()
print("识别结果:", result) # 输出JSON格式文本
四、挑战与未来:算力、模型与生态的协同进化
4.1 当前挑战
- 算力限制:低端设备(如百元级MCU)难以运行复杂模型,需进一步优化。
- 方言与噪音:嘈杂环境或方言口音下准确率下降,需结合多模态(如唇语识别)提升鲁棒性。
- 生态碎片化:不同框架(Vosk/DeepSpeech)的模型格式不兼容,增加迁移成本。
4.2 未来趋势
- 边缘计算融合:5G+边缘节点部署ASR服务,平衡本地算力与云端扩展性。
- 自监督学习:利用海量未标注音频数据预训练模型,降低对标注数据的依赖。
- 标准化接口:推动ONNX等模型格式统一,简化跨平台部署。
五、结语:纯本地ASR,开启自主可控的语音交互时代
纯本地实时语音转文字技术不仅是效率工具,更是数据主权与安全底线的守护者。对于开发者而言,选择合适的模型与硬件方案,可快速构建高可用应用;对于企业用户,本地化部署能显著降低合规风险与长期成本。随着端侧AI芯片的持续进化,纯本地ASR必将从“可用”迈向“普惠”,成为万物互联时代的标配能力。
行动建议:
- 评估场景需求:明确是否需要离线、多语言或实时性,选择对应框架。
- 测试模型性能:在目标设备上运行基准测试(如WER词错率、延迟),优化模型与硬件匹配。
- 关注开源生态:参与Vosk、DeepSpeech等社区,获取最新模型与技术支持。
纯本地实时语音转文字,已正式起飞!
发表评论
登录后可评论,请前往 登录 或 注册